Overall: I thought it was a good start to a series with a unique premise but slow pacing and both characters doing something awful lowered my score. Note this review contains words that might be triggering. 16 episodes about 45 minutes each. Aired on: Viki https://www.viki.com/videos/1262518v-desire-the-series-episode-1 ; GagaOOLala (not available in Japan or Korea) https://www.gagaoolala.com/en/videos/5570/desire-2025 and Heavenly (South Korea) https://heavenly.tv/en/detail/955 Was originally also on iQIYI, WeTV, Youku and YouTube but was removed mid-airing.
Content Warnings: two rapes both shown, past intimate partner abuse, intimate partner abuse, non con kisses, non con touching, manipulation, sexual harassment, fights, blood, kidnapping, attempted murder, gaslighting, lovebombing, non con kissing turned consensual, self harm
What I Liked
- unique premise for a live action series
- visuals
- how Hua Yong stayed consistent in his characterization
- an extremely wide release, might be the most platforms I've seen so far for a BL series
Room For Improvement
- in both couples one character raped the other character and both were shot in a romantic way and of course we know how this ends, I don't give af about fictional biology that made at least 1 allegedly not have a choice, both characters were jerks and abusive and I don't want them in a romantic relationship with anyone.
- I can enjoy a player getting played but the problem here is we never really see the player being a player and he is so manipulated that his biology got changed without his consent and he had pain/problems from the master manipulator who supposedly loved him. For me the manipulator treated a person like an object to own and it was about power and control which is abuse and not love.
- slow pacing in with both couples, felt like they went in circles for a long time
- the exposition dump/world building dump in ep 1; however, I realize that many people aren't familiar with the setting so it was a fast way to give everyone the basics
- Hua Yong's backstory was given too late
- the narration/mysterious voice in episode 15
- extremely rushed finale with a multi year time skip, that it was the dad that told him, how Shen Wen Lang was a jerk almost until the very end and then did not have nearly enough groveling and their story didn't really have a satisfying resolution
